barcode-tool

barcode-tool is a lightweight npm package that facilitates barcode generation and detection. It leverages the Barcode Detection API for barcode scanning directly in web browsers and provides an intuitive interface for generating various barcode formats. Seamlessly integrate barcode functionality into your web applications for tasks such as inventory management, product identification, and more.

Supported Barcode Detector Formats

  • aztec
  • code_128
  • code_39
  • code_93
  • codabar
  • data_matrix
  • ean_13
  • ean_8
  • itf
  • pdf417
  • qr_code
  • upc_a
  • upc_e
  • unknown

Supported Barcode Generator Formats

  • CODE39
  • CODE128
  • CODE128A
  • CODE128B
  • CODE128C
  • EAN13
  • EAN8
  • EAN5
  • EAN2
  • UPC
  • UPCE
  • ITF
  • ITF14
  • MSI10
  • MSI11
  • MSI1010
  • MSI1110
  • pharmacode
  • codabar
  • GenericBarcode

Installation

You can install the barcode-tool via npm:

npm install barcode-tool

or via yarn:

yarn add barcode-tool

or importing the package with script tag via JSDelivr CDN:

<head>
    <script src="https://cdn.jsdelivr.net/npm/[email protected]/dist/cjs/index.js"></script>
</head>

Alternatively, you can import the package with a script tag using Unpkg CDN:

<head>
    <script src="https://unpkg.com/[email protected]/dist/cjs/index.js"></script>
</head>

Methods

detectBarcode

  • Method for getting the value in the provided barcode image.
detectBarcode Parameters

Name | Type | Description -------|-------------------|---- payload | Object | An object containing the following properties: image | HTMLElement Blob HTMLCanvasElement HTMLImageElement HTMLVideoElement ImageBitmap ImageData SVGImageElement | The image containing the barcode. formats | string[] (optional) | Optional array of barcode formats to detect.

generateBarcode

  • Method for generating barcode
generateBarcode Parameters

Name | Type | Description -------|-------------------|---- payload | Object | An object containing the following properties: elementId | string | The image containing the barcode. value | string | The value to encode in the barcode. options | BarcodeOptions (optional) | Optional settings for customizing the appearance of the barcode.

BarcodeOptions Parameter

| Name | Type | Description | |----------------|----------------|------------------------------------------------------------| | options.format | string (optional) | The format of the barcode. Default is auto. | | options.width | number (optional) | The width of the barcode bars. Default is 2. | | options.height | number (optional) | The height of the barcode bars. Default is 100. | | options.displayValue| boolean (optional)| Whether to display the value below the barcode. Default is true. | | options.text | string (optional) | Additional text to display below the barcode. | | options.fontOptions | string (optional) | Additional font options for the text below the barcode. | | options.font | string (optional) | The font family for the text below the barcode. Default is monospace. | | options.textAlign | string (optional) | The alignment of the text below the barcode. Default is center. | | options.textPosition| string (optional) | The position of the text below the barcode. Default is bottom. | | options.textMargin | number (optional) | The margin between the barcode and the text below it. Default is 2. | | options.fontSize | number (optional) | The font size for the text below the barcode. Default is 20. | | options.background | string (optional) | The background color of the barcode. Default is #ffffff. | | options.lineColor | string (optional) | The color of the barcode bars. Default is #000000. | | options.margin | number (optional) | The margin around the barcode. Default is 10. | | options.marginTop | number (optional) | The top margin around the barcode. | | options.marginBottom| number (optional) | The bottom margin around the barcode. | | options.marginLeft | number (optional) | The left margin around the barcode. | | options.marginRight | number (optional) | The right margin around the barcode. | | options.valid | function (optional) | A callback function to validate the generated barcode. |

getSupportedFormats

  • Method that specify all of the barcode formats that are available for detection, and generation of barcodes.

Sample usage with package manager/bundler

Sample Usage

import { detectBarcode } from 'barcode-tool';

const handleDetectBarcode = async () => {
    try {
        const elementWithBarcode = document.getElementById('element-with-barcode');

         // Specify optional formats to detect
        const formats = ['ean_13', 'qr_code'];
        const barcodes = await detectBarcode({ image: elementWithBarcode, formats });
        console.log("handleDetectBarcode ~ barcodes:", barcodes)
    } catch (error) {
        console.error('Error on detecting barcodes:', error.message);
    }
}
import { getSupportedFormats } from 'barcode-tool';

const handleGetSupportedFormats = async () => {
    try {
        const supportedFormats = await getSupportedFormats();
        console.log("handleGetSupportedFormats ~ supportedFormats:", supportedFormats)
    } catch (error) {
        console.log("handleGetSupportedFormats ~ error:", error)
    }
}
import { generateBarcode } from 'barcode-tool';

const handleGenerateBarcode = () => {
    try {
        const payload = { elementId: 'barcode-container', value: 'your-barcode-value' };
        const options = { /* your BarcodeOptions here */ };
        generateBarcode({ ...payload, options });
    } catch (error) {
        console.error('Error generating barcode:', error.message);
    }
}
